+[* black] Now bezel-less the screen is ready for some (amazingly heat-free) prying!
+[* black] The screen assembly is only adhered along the outer edges, probably to allow the screen to drift as it opens and folds, which also serves to make removal much easier.
+ [* black] That said, replacing this (very fragile) screen will probably blow your budget, if you can ever find one.
+[* icon_note] Using a plastic instead of glass as an OLED substrate means this display is much less likely to shatter, but judging by [https://ifixit.org/blog/16025/galaxy-fold-failure-causes/|early reviews] there are [https://www.theverge.com/2019/4/17/18411510/samsung-galaxy-fold-broken-screen-debris-dust-hinge-flexible-bulge|plenty] of [https://twitter.com/MKBHD/status/1118580472576118787|ways] for this display to [https://twitter.com/stevekovach/status/1118571414934753280|fail].
+[* black] The display itself is mounted to two thin metal plates that are in turn adhered to the phone's frame, with only a single ultra-wide display cable on the left side of the phone.
+ [* black] It appears that the Verge's reported "[https://www.theverge.com/2019/4/19/18498904/samsung-galaxy-fold-review-screen-broken-issue-durability-foldable-phone-video-performance-price|Jelly scrolling]" is likely due to the [https://www.xda-developers.com/oneplus-is-aware-of-the-jelly-scrolling-effect-some-oneplus-5-owners-are-reporting/|display driver] software, not a split display.
